Are there other common things that have this property? I can’t think of any. — Joe M., Ashland Well, Joe, all substances can exist in those three phases. The unique thing about water is that it's the only substance that exists in all three at temperatures commonly found on Earth. Ice melts to water at above 32 degrees Fahrenheit (zero degrees Celsius) and water turns to vapor above 212 degrees (100 Celsius). Other substances change phases at different temperatures. Nitrogen becomes solid, or freezes, at minus 346 degrees. Metals, on the other hand, remain solid at temperatures of many hundreds of degrees. Remember that the change from one state to another is not a chemical change but a physical one. The differences are in the distance between the molecules or ions, and how actively those particles are moving. Advertisement Substances can exist in other states as well. One is liquid crystal, in which the arrangement of molecules differs from that in both liquid and solid crystal states. Substances that form liquid crystal structures are common (as high as .5 percent of all known carbon compounds, for example). Yet another state is plasma, but since you said "common," we’ll skip plasma, which is more important in astronomy and high-energy physics.
